数据库参数组是什么

不及物动词 其他 30

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库参数组是一组预定义的参数配置集合,用于配置和优化数据库服务器的行为和性能。它包含了一系列的参数设置,如缓冲区大小、并发连接数、日志写入频率等,可以根据数据库的需求进行调整和修改。以下是关于数据库参数组的五个重要点:

    1. 参数设置:数据库参数组中包含了一系列的参数设置,用于配置数据库服务器的行为。这些参数可以控制数据库的缓存、并发连接数、日志写入频率等行为。通过调整这些参数,可以优化数据库的性能和稳定性。

    2. 分类和分类:数据库参数组可以根据不同的数据库引擎和版本进行分类。每个分类下可以有多个具体的参数组。例如,MySQL数据库可以有一个参数组用于配置InnoDB引擎,另一个参数组用于配置MyISAM引擎。

    3. 参数修改:可以对数据库参数组中的参数进行修改。修改参数可以通过控制台、命令行或API进行。在修改参数之前,应该仔细考虑参数的含义和影响,并测试修改后的效果。需要注意的是,某些参数的修改可能需要重启数据库服务器才能生效。

    4. 参数组的继承:数据库参数组可以通过继承的方式进行配置。这意味着,可以创建一个新的参数组,并继承一个现有的参数组的设置。通过继承,可以方便地对参数进行修改,而不会影响到其他数据库实例的配置。

    5. 参数组的应用:数据库参数组可以应用到具体的数据库实例中。当创建新的数据库实例时,可以选择一个参数组作为该实例的配置。数据库实例会根据参数组的设置来运行和优化。如果需要修改参数,可以先复制一个新的参数组,并在新的参数组中进行修改,然后将新的参数组应用到数据库实例中。

    总之,数据库参数组是用于配置和优化数据库服务器的一组参数设置。通过合理地设置参数,可以提高数据库的性能和稳定性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库参数组(DB parameter group)是用于管理和配置数据库引擎的参数集合。它是数据库引擎提供的一种功能,用于控制数据库实例的行为和性能。

    数据库参数组包含了一系列参数的设置,这些参数可以影响数据库实例的运行方式。通过修改参数组中的参数值,可以调整数据库的性能、可用性和安全性等方面的行为。

    数据库参数组中的参数可以分为两类:静态参数和动态参数。

    静态参数是指只能在数据库实例创建时或重启后才能生效的参数。修改静态参数会导致数据库实例的重启。

    动态参数是指可以在数据库实例运行时即时生效的参数。修改动态参数不需要重启数据库实例。

    数据库参数组可以被多个数据库实例共享,这意味着可以将相同的参数配置应用于多个数据库实例,从而实现统一的配置管理。

    创建数据库实例时,需要选择一个数据库参数组作为实例的参数配置。如果没有合适的参数组可用,可以创建一个新的参数组,或者选择一个现有的参数组进行修改。

    通过修改数据库参数组中的参数,可以对数据库实例的性能进行优化。不同的参数设置可以影响数据库的缓存大小、并发连接数、查询优化器行为等,从而对数据库的性能产生影响。

    总之,数据库参数组是一种用于管理和配置数据库引擎参数的集合,通过修改参数组中的参数值,可以调整数据库实例的行为和性能。它是提供给用户控制数据库实例行为的一种重要工具。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库参数组是一组数据库参数的集合,用于管理和配置数据库实例的参数。数据库参数组可以包含各种参数,如内存分配、并发连接数、查询优化、日志记录等。通过修改数据库参数组,可以优化数据库的性能、提高可靠性、增强安全性等。

    数据库参数组可以在创建数据库实例时指定,也可以在数据库实例运行过程中进行修改。每个数据库实例可以关联一个数据库参数组,当数据库实例启动时,它会读取关联的数据库参数组中的参数值。

    数据库参数组可以根据需求进行自定义配置,也可以使用预定义的参数组。预定义的参数组是云服务提供商或数据库软件厂商提供的一组经过优化的参数配置,适用于不同的应用场景和工作负载。用户可以根据自己的需求选择合适的预定义参数组,也可以根据实际情况进行自定义参数配置。

    下面是配置数据库参数组的操作流程:

    1. 登录数据库管理控制台,选择目标数据库实例。
    2. 进入数据库实例的参数组页面,可以查看当前关联的参数组和参数配置。
    3. 如果需要修改参数配置,可以创建一个新的数据库参数组,或者复制一个已有的参数组进行修改。
    4. 在新建或复制的参数组中,可以修改各个参数的值。参数的具体含义和取值范围可以参考数据库软件的官方文档或云服务提供商的文档。
    5. 修改完成后,将新的参数组关联到目标数据库实例。关联数据库参数组时,可以选择立即生效或者在下次重启数据库实例时生效。
    6. 验证参数配置的效果,可以观察数据库实例的性能指标、日志记录等。

    需要注意的是,修改数据库参数可能会对数据库实例的性能和稳定性产生影响,所以在修改参数之前应该仔细评估和测试。建议在修改参数之前备份数据库,以防止意外情况发生。另外,不同的数据库软件和版本可能有不同的参数配置方式和参数含义,需要根据具体情况进行操作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部